ABSTRACT

Background: Emerging Long COVID research indicates the condition has major population health consequence. Other chronic conditions have previously been associated with functional and mental health challenges - including depression, anxiety, post-traumatic stress disorder (PTSD), suicide ideation, substance use and lower life satisfaction. Methods: This study explores correlations between self-reported Long COVID, functional and mental health challenges among a random community-based sample of people (n = 655) aged 20-50 years who contracted COVID-19 prior to vaccination in a Texas county. A random sample of eligible participants was mailed a link to participate in a semi-structured questionnaire. Participant responses, including open-ended responses regarding their experience following COVID-19, were paired with health system data. Results: Long COVID was associated with increased presence of depression (13% increase), anxiety (28% increase), suicide ideation (10% increase), PTSD (20% increase), and decreased life satisfaction and daily functioning. Structural equation modeling, controlling for sociodemographic variables and imposing a theoretical framework from existing chronic disease research, demonstrated correlations between Long COVID and higher PTSD, suicide ideation and lower life satisfaction were mediated by higher daily functional challenges and common mental disorders. Conclusions: Basic and applied, interdisciplinary research is urgently needed to characterize the population-based response to the new challenge of Long COVID.

ABSTRACT

Children are capable of initiating COVID-19 transmission into households, but many questions remain about the impact of vaccination on transmission. Data from a COVID-19 Delta variant outbreak at an overnight camp in Texas during June 23-27, 2021 were analyzed. The camp had 451 attendees, including 364 youths aged <18 years and 87 adults. Detailed interviews were conducted with 92 (20.4%) of consenting attendees and 117 household members of interviewed attendees with COVID-19. Among 450 attendees with known case status, the attack rate was 41%, including 42% among youths; attack rates were lower among vaccinated (13%) than among unvaccinated youths (48%). The secondary attack rate was 51% among 115 household contacts of 55 interviewed index patients. Secondary infections occurred in 67% of unvaccinated household members and 33% of fully or partially vaccinated household members. Analyses suggested that household member vaccination and camp attendee masking at home protected against household transmission.

ABSTRACT

OBJECTIVE: SARS-CoV-2 has caused a pandemic claiming more than 4 million lives worldwide. Overwhelming COVID-19 respiratory failure placed tremendous demands on healthcare systems increasing the death toll. Cost-effective prognostic tools to characterise the likelihood of patients with COVID-19 to progress to severe hypoxemic respiratory failure are still needed. DESIGN: We conducted a retrospective cohort study to develop a model using demographic and clinical data collected in the first 12 hours of admission to explore associations with severe hypoxemic respiratory failure in unvaccinated and hospitalised patients with COVID-19. SETTING: University-based healthcare system including six hospitals located in the Galveston, Brazoria and Harris counties of Texas. PARTICIPANTS: Adult patients diagnosed with COVID-19 and admitted to one of six hospitals between 19 March and 30 June 2020. PRIMARY OUTCOME: The primary outcome was defined as reaching a WHO ordinal scale between 6 and 9 at any time during admission, which corresponded to severe hypoxemic respiratory failure requiring high-flow oxygen supplementation or mechanical ventilation. RESULTS: We included 329 participants in the model cohort and 62 (18.8%) met the primary outcome. Our multivariable regression model found that lactate dehydrogenase (OR 2.36), Quick Sequential Organ Failure Assessment score (OR 2.26) and neutrophil to lymphocyte ratio (OR 1.15) were significant predictors of severe disease. The final model showed an area under the curve of 0.84. The sensitivity analysis and point of influence analysis did not reveal inconsistencies. CONCLUSIONS: Our study suggests that a combination of accessible demographic and clinical information collected on admission may predict the progression to severe COVID-19 among adult patients with mild and moderate disease. This model requires external validation prior to its use.

ABSTRACT

Public health in the United States has long been challenged by budget cuts and a declining workforce. The COVID-19 pandemic exposed the vulnerabilities left by years of neglecting this crucial frontline defense against emerging infectious diseases. In the early days of the pandemic, the University of Texas Medical Branch and the Galveston County Health District (GCHD) partnered to bolster Galveston County's public health response. We mobilized interprofessional teams of students and provided training to implement projects identified by GCHD as necessary for responding to the pandemic. We provided a safe outlet for students to contribute to their community by creating remote volunteer opportunities when students faced displacement from clinical rotations and in-person didactics converted to virtual formats. As students gradually returned to clinical rotations and didactic demands increased, it became necessary to expand volunteer efforts beyond what had initially been mostly hand-selected student teams. We have passed the initial emergency response phase of COVID-19 in Galveston County and are transitioning into more long-term opportunities as COVID-19 moves from pandemic to endemic. In this case study, we describe our successes and lessons learned.
